Top Five Christmas Gift Ideas for Little Girls
To make this festive season a little more fun and a little less frustrating here’s a list of fantastic gift ideas for girls:
Dress Up
Girls love jewellery no matter how young or old they are. Fortunately buying jewellery for the little ones won’t break the bank. They love sparkly sets of stick on earrings, bangles, beads, lockets and rings – you’ll never go wrong with this option.
Girls also love to play dress up. If she’s seriously in to fairy princesses this year get her a little outfit that she can parade around in with a wand and perhaps a crown – she’ll feel like the princess she is in no time. There are loads of little outfits out there from her favourite cartoon hero, to her ultimate girly fantasy – and don’t forget a pair of grown up little fluffy or sparkly heels are always a winner. If she’s a little older, and you should always ask for the parents’ consent here, you could get her a little makeup set – they love to emulate their mums and having their own fun makeup will make them feel all grown up.
Educational & Games
Learning doesn’t have to be boring, in fact educational gifts always go down a treat – and it’s not only the kids but the parents who’ll love you too. A set of books, an artists easel and a paint set, crayons, colouring in books, building blocks, puzzles or a chemistry set all make good Christmas gifts for girls.
All kids love games – whether they’re board games or games they can play outside. Games are an especially good gift suggestion if there’s more than one kid in the family. Try looking for games that they can play together like kid’s scrabble, swing ball, mini golf, twister or magic cards. Preferably break them out when the adults are looking for a bit of peace and quite – which tends to happen quite often over the festive season.
Dolls
Dolls are always a great idea when looking for a Christmas gift for a little girl. One thing you need to remember that dolls are not simply little plastic babies anymore. They come in every shape and size, they cry, they eat, they walk and talk, some of them look like disco divas and others like punks or emos (scary I know) so you’ll need to browse through the options on offer and select one. If you get lost just give her mum a call she’ll know which one will go down best because rest assured she’s been listening to the “I want a new doll" for a few weeks now.
Soft Toys
These are winners with the younger set. Buying a fluffy, cuddly toy for your little princess to snuggle with as she watches telly or dreams her big dreams at night is a good gift idea. I’m sure that if you think back to your childhood you’ll remember how much you treasured your favourite soft toy (mine was a bear named Rupert – original, I know) Give a gift that will be loved as much as you loved it this Christmas.
Pretend, Pretend
Little girls love to play make believe. They want to emulate their parents, their older siblings and even what they see on TV. They love playing “house" or going to “work" by playing with their doctor or chef sets. From their pretend ovens, to their tiny grow your own garden sets, and doctors’ medical bags the kids will be in their own little fantasy world for hours at a time.
